学而实习之 不亦乐乎

Nginx:PHP 网站 502 错误

2021-01-08 21:28:49

PHP网页突然打不开了,查看 Nginx 日志发现以下错误日志:
[error] 26964#0: *1 upstream sent too big header while reading response header from upstream ... ...

解决办法:

在 nginx.conf 的 http 配置节,加入下面的配置:

proxy_buffer_size  128k;
proxy_buffers   32 32k;
proxy_busy_buffers_size 128k;

重启后一般就可以解决,如果还是报502,再加入下面配置:

fastcgi_buffer_size 128k;
fastcgi_buffers 4 256k;
fastcgi_busy_buffers_size 256k;